^^Yom Kippur and the fast that goes along with it begin at sunset Friday, and ends at sunset Saturday.
It's the most solemn date on the Jewish calendar. The fact that it falls on the Sabbath makes it an even more significant event. Observant Jews will attend services on Friday night and will also be in synagogue most of the day on Saturday.
